There are some problems in HRM3400B raw meal vertical grinding system of a 5 000t/d cement clinker production line, such as high power consumption, high resistance, low operation efficiency, high comprehensive moisture content of grinding materials, many air leakage points of the system, large air leakage and so on. And then it are upgraded by optimizing the structure of cyclone inlet, heightening the inlet and upper shell of whirlwind cylinder, lengthening the inner cylinder of whirlwind cylinder, adding hot air pipe, increasing the angle of grinding sliver, adding buffer box at the end of slag discharge belt conveyor, replacing the grinding roller seal cover with a new type of internal labyrinth seal cover, removing the lower pressure reamer of cyclone tube and replacing it with unpowered flip plate valve, replacing all the dust collector cylinders with stainless steel materials, etc. After revamping, the pressure difference of raw meal vertical grinding machine is reduced by 183Pa, the oxygen content of waste gas at the end of online kiln is reduced by 1.8% and 2.0%, and the power consumption of mill is reduced from 16.33kW.h/t to 13.70kW.h/t. The production cost is effectively reduced and the transformation effect is remarkable.
